High Efficiency Water Softener

Although the EPA has no published limits on calcium and magnesium, these minerals can have devastating affects on your home’s plumbing and ability to clean. Clothes can look dingy and feel rough and scratchy. Also, dishes and glasses get spotted and a film may build up on shower doors, bathtubs, sinks and faucets. Washing your hair in hard water may leave it feeling sticky and dull. Importantly, scale can build-up in pipes while lowering water pressure throughout the house. The EPA maximum allowable levels for iron as a secondary contaminant is .3 parts per million and for manganese is .05 parts per million. Small amounts of these minerals can have very noticeable, even devastating affects on your home’s water quality.

OTHER AFFECTS OF HARD WATER

Hard water scale can build up inside hot water heaters, insulating the temperature sensor inside the tank and creating extra work to bring the temperature up to the set level. Consequently, this will reduce the life of your hot water heater and likely require early replacement. Also, there is the potential for corrosion inside pipes. You may see staining throughout the home’s showers, bathtubs, and sinks. Hot water heaters may fail way ahead of their normal useful life.  For more information on hard water, see the link at usgs.gov/edu/hardness.html.

A water softener is effective in removing dissolved forms of ironmanganese and hardness minerals (magnesium & calcium). However, Particulate forms of these minerals will need a sediment filter for removal.
